Problem

The development of new maize varieties and hybrids is a time-consuming process, taking six to twelve years, and existing technologies face challenges in combining desirable traits such as disease resistance, drought tolerance, and high yield in a stable and agronomically sound manner.

Innovation Solution

The introduction of the novel maize variety PH4DG8, which incorporates traits like male sterility, disease resistance, and improved agronomic characteristics through backcross conversion, genetic manipulation, and transformation, allowing for the creation of stable, high-yielding hybrids with specific loci conversions.

Data Source

PatentUS11730115B1Maize inbred PH4DG8
Publication Date: 2023.08.22 PIONEER HI BREED INTERNATIONAL INC

AI summary

A novel maize variety designated PH4DG8 and seed, plants and plant parts thereof are provided. Methods for producing a maize plant comprise crossing maize variety PH4DG8 with another maize plant are provided. Methods for producing a maize plant containing in its genetic material one or more traits introgressed into PH4DG8 through backcross conversion and/or transformation, and to the maize seed, plant and plant part produced thereby are provided. Hybrid maize seed, plants or plant parts are produced by crossing the variety PH4DG8 or a locus conversion of PH4DG8 with another maize variety.
